6. UI/UX QUALITY

Accessibility Features

Semantic HTML:

  • Proper heading hierarchy (h1 → h6)
  • <section> with aria-labelledby
  • Form labels properly associated
  • <main> with id="main-content"

ARIA Attributes:

  • aria-label on inputs, buttons
  • aria-hidden on decorative icons
  • role="search" on filter bars
  • role="status" for loading states
  • role="alert" for error messages
  • aria-labelledby linking sections

Keyboard Navigation:

  • Focus visible on all interactive elements
  • Focus ring styling (ring-2 ring-ring)
  • Skip to main content link (fixed position, -translate-y-16 hidden)
  • Tab order follows document flow

Example from Landing Page:

<a
  href="#main-content"
  className="fixed left-2 top-2 z-[100] -translate-y-16 rounded-md 
             bg-primary px-4 py-2 text-sm font-medium text-primary-foreground 
             shadow-lg transition-transform focus:translate-y-0"
>
  {t('skipToContent')}
</a>

11. SECURITY ANALYSIS

Headers & CSP

Security Headers:

X-Content-Type-Options: nosniff          // Prevent MIME sniffing
X-Frame-Options: DENY                    // No iframe embedding
X-XSS-Protection: 1; mode=block         // Legacy XSS protection
Referrer-Policy: strict-origin-when-cross-origin
Strict-Transport-Security: max-age=31536000 (1 year) + preload
Permissions-Policy:
  - camera: disabled
  - microphone: disabled
  - geolocation: self only
  - payment: self only

Content Security Policy:

default-src: 'self'
script-src: 'self' 'unsafe-inline' 'unsafe-eval' https://api.mapbox.com
style-src: 'self' 'unsafe-inline' https://api.mapbox.com
img-src: 'self' data: blob: https://*.mapbox.com https://*.tiles.mapbox.com https:
font-src: 'self' data:
connect-src: 'self' https://*.mapbox.com https://api.mapbox.com https://events.mapbox.com
worker-src: 'self' blob:
child-src: 'self' blob:
frame-ancestors: 'none'
base-uri: 'self'
form-action: 'self'

Issues Found: ⚠️ UNSAFE-INLINE & UNSAFE-EVAL in CSP

  • Currently allows inline scripts for Next.js development
  • Recommendation: In production, use NEXT_STRICT_CSP_POLICY env var
  • Configuration exists but needs to be enabled

CSRF Protection

Implemented:

function getCsrfToken(): string | undefined {
  if (typeof document === 'undefined') return undefined;
  const match = document.cookie.match(/(?:^|;\s*)XSRF-TOKEN=([^;]*)/);
  return match?.[1] ? decodeURIComponent(match[1]) : undefined;
}

// Auto-injected for non-safe methods
csrfHeaders['X-CSRF-Token'] = csrfToken;

Safe Methods: GET, HEAD, OPTIONS (no token needed)
